News

British tourists planning trips to Ecuador will need to comply with new customs regulations. The Foreign Office has updated ...
Horseshoe Bay Beach, Bermuda Bermuda is known for its pink-sand beaches, and Horseshoe Bay Beach, one of the many beaches on the island that are open to the public, is the cream of the crop.
Hardly any place in the world evokes as many ideas of paradise as the islands of the Lesser Antilles in the Caribbean.